Overview Lebtin 16mg Tablet

Ménière's disease, an inner ear disorder causing vertigo, tinnitus, and hearing loss (likely due to excess inner ear fluid), is treated and prevented with the 16mg Lebtin tablet. This medication alleviates symptoms by decreasing fluid buildup. For optimal results, swallow the entire 16mg Lebtin tablet with water at consistent times daily. Dosage and frequency are determined by your physician, who will also determine treatment duration (often several months). Continue taking Lebtin as prescribed, even with symptom improvement. Common side effects are headache, nausea, and dyspepsia; abdominal pain and bloating may also occur. Taking Lebtin with food might lessen stomach upset. Inform your doctor of any pre-existing conditions, such as stomach ulcers, asthma, hypertension, or hypotension, before starting this medication. Always disclose all other medications to avoid potential interactions. Consult your physician if pregnant, planning pregnancy, or breastfeeding.

How Lebtin 16mg Tablet works:

Histamine-like Lebtin 16mg tablets enhance inner ear circulation, thereby lessening the buildup of fluid. This fluid accumulation triggers vertigo, nausea, and dizziness—hallmarks of Ménière's disease—by transmitting aberrant signals to the brain. Lebtin 16mg tablets also attenuate these nerve signals, providing Ménière's disease symptom relief.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holSAFE

Lebtin 16mg Tablet can be taken with alcohol without adverse reactions.

PregnancyPreg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

The use of Lebtin 16mg tablets during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to a developing fetus. A physician will assess the potential benefits against any risks pr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ice before taking this medication.

Breast feedingBreast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

The use of Lebtin 16mg tablets while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icates potential transfer of the medication into breast milk, posing a possible risk to the infant.

DrivingDrivingSAFE

Driving ability is typically unaffected by Lebtin 16mg tablets.

KidneyKid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ED

The use of Lebtin 16mg tablets in individuals with kidney disease appears to pose minimal risk. Current evidence indicates dose modification may be unnecessary; however, medical advice is recommended.

LiverLiverC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

Insufficient data exists regarding the use of Lebtin 16mg tablets in individuals with hepatic impairment. Physician consultation is advised.

Meniere's disease affects the inner ear, causing balance and hearing problems. Characteristic symptoms are vertigo, fluctuating hearing loss, tinnitus, and ear pressure. Nausea and vomiting can result from the dizziness. Treatment varies, so consulting your doctor is crucial to develop a personalized treatment plan.

Meniere's disease may be triggered by various factors, including stress, overwork, fatigue, emotional distress, other illnesses, and changes in pressure. Dietary triggers may include dairy, caffeine, alcohol, and high-sodium foods. A low-sodium diet (2 grams/day) can help manage vertigo associated with Meniere's disease.
Remember to take Lebtin 16mg Tablet as soon as you realize you've missed a dose. If it's nearly time for your next dose, skip the missed one and continue with your regular schedule. Never take a double dose to compensate; this could lead to side effects.
Vertigo can be triggered by mental stress, which may also exacerbate existing vertigo, but stress alone doesn't cause it.
Vertigo can stem from a sudden blood pressure drop or dehydration. Rapidly rising from a seated or lying position often induces lightheadedness. Additionally, motion sickness, some medications, and inner ear issues (such as Meniere's disease or acoustic neuroma) can trigger vertigo. It's crucial to remember that vertigo may also signal other conditions, including multiple sclerosis or post-head trauma complications.
